Safety communication settings (safety programmable controller)

8.2.4
Configure the safety communication settings of the safety programmable controller such as communication
destinations, safety data transfer devices, transmission interval monitoring times, and safety refresh monitoring
times. Set a transmission interval monitoring time and safety refresh monitoring time that satisfy the conditions
shown in "8.2.10 Transmission interval monitoring time" and "8.2.11 Safety refresh monitoring time".
